12736. Jesus, The Word Of Mercy Give

1 Jesus, the word of mercy give,
And let it swiftly run,
And let the priests themselves believe,
And put salvation on.

2 Clothed in the Spirit’s holiness
May all Thy people prove
The plenitude of Gospel grace
The joy of perfect love.

3 Jesus, let all Thy lovers shine,
Illustrious, as the sun;
And bright with borrowed rays divine,
Their glorious circuit run.

4 Beyond the reach of mortals spread
Their light where’er they go;
Heavenly influence may they shed
On all the world below.

5 As giants may they run their race,
Exulting in their might:
As burning luminaries chase
The gloom of hellish night.

6 As the bright Son of Righteousness
Their healing wings display;
And let their luster still increase
Unto the perfect day.

Text Information
First Line: Jesus, the word of mercy give
Title: Jesus, The Word Of Mercy Give
Author (vs. 1-2): Charles Wesley
Meter: CM
Language: English
Source: Vs. 1-2: Short Hymns on Select Passages of Holy Scriptures (Bristol, England: E. Farley, 1762); Vs. 3-6: A Selection of Hymns, from Various Authors, Designed as a Suplement to the Methodist Pocket Hymn Book (New York: 1808), alt.
Copyright: Public Domain
Notes: Alternate tunes: CAITHNESS from Scottish "Psalter," 1635, DUNDEE from Scottish "Psalter," 1615, ST. AGNES by John B. Dykes
Tune Information
Name: BROWN
Composer: William Batchelder Bradbury (1844)
Meter: CM
Key: B♭ Major
Copyright: Public Domain
